strange bug in plperl - Mailing list pgsql-hackers

From Andrew Dunstan
Subject strange bug in plperl
Date
Msg-id 40E958C6.8070009@dunslane.net
Whole thread Raw
Responses Re: strange bug in plperl  (Darko Prenosil <darko.prenosil@finteh.hr>)
Re: strange bug in plperl  (Tom Lane <tgl@sss.pgh.pa.us>)
Re: [Plperlng-devel] strange bug in plperl  (Sergej Sergeev <ggray@inbox.ru>)
Re: strange bug in plperl  (ggray <ggray@bird.cris.net>)
List pgsql-hackers
Can anyone suggest why I might be seeing this effect (each notice comes 
out once per row plus once per function call)

thanks

andrew

andrew=# create function tstset() returns setof tst language plperl as $$
andrew$# elog(NOTICE,"tstset called");
andrew$# return [{i=>1,v=>"one"},{i=>2,v=>"two"}];
andrew$# $$;
CREATE FUNCTION
andrew=# select * from tstset();
NOTICE:  tstset called
NOTICE:  tstset called
NOTICE:  tstset calledi |  v 
---+-----1 | one2 | two
(2 rows)



pgsql-hackers by date:

Previous
From: "John Hansen"
Date:
Subject: Re: Relay Access Denied
Next
From: Andrew Dunstan
Date:
Subject: Re: Bug in PL/Perl CVS head w/spi patch